Wansdyke School is looking for an enthusiastic and caring Teaching Assistant to join its friendly team on a maternity cover contract and provide support to pupils, starting from September 2026.

Working Hours: Part-time (31.25 hours per week, Monday to Friday, 38 weeks per year, term-time only). Contract: Maternity Cover (effective from September 2026).

We are a vibrant non-denominational single form entry primary school, educating children between the ages of 4 and 11. Located in the market town of Devizes, Wiltshire, we are proud to have very incredible children, who show exceptional behaviour and attitude to learning. We have a supportive parent body and a 28 place Complex Needs Resource Base, which supports children with additional needs from across the county. Our passionate staff are committed to raising standards and achieving excellence and, in 2021, we retained our ‘Good’ Ofsted rating and were praised for providing a purposeful and engaging curriculum, which allows pupils to flourish personally and academically. We are part of Acorn Education Trust, which provides exciting opportunities to improve local education and draw on collective experience.

As a Teaching Assistant, you must be able to work across all age ranges and be prepared to work flexibly to support children of all abilities, including those requiring SEND support.
